Output 99faf0ebe7b9a559703a0566549007db9c5ffd57ed4a64063be06e6d0b30b013:23

value
66845520
script pubkey
OP_0 OP_PUSHBYTES_20 dc93b03daf83cd4f57b89c408ce73f1e586ffa93
address
bc1qmjfmq0d0s0x574acn3qgeeelrevxl75ndq789s
transaction
99faf0ebe7b9a559703a0566549007db9c5ffd57ed4a64063be06e6d0b30b013
spent
true